Assessment of Improvement in Experience of Denture Wearers on Using Mandibular Dentures Fabricated Using Neutral Zone Technique: A Prospective Clinical Study

Abstract


Background:  The purpose of this study was to evaluate any improvement in experience of denture wearers, who could not be provided with implant- dentures, when provided with lower dentures fabricated using neutral zone technique. Materials and methods: A group of 20 patients was selected and provided with good pairs of complete dentures made conventionally (CVD). After an adjustment period of 30 days they were asked to fill a verified Hindi version of OHIP-14 questionnaire which was believed to reflect their OHRQol inversely. The group of patients were then given the lower dentures made using neutral zone technique (NZTD). After adjustment phase got over, they were asked to fill the same questionnaires again. The OHIP-14 scores obtained in this way were analyzed using paired-t test. Results: The mean OHIP-14 H score was significantly more for the denture wearers with CVDs as compared to those wearing NZTDs. Conclusion: It can be said that neutral zone technique is a good way to improve the function of lower dentures and enhance patients OHRQol in cases where implant-based treatment is not an option.
